Patrick Reed wins the first event of LIV; Sergio Garcia earns an open place


Carrollton, Texas – Patrick Reed lost the lead with 3-over 75, and then by aderio, 15 feet birds in the first hole of the four Golf Dallas, his first title from the Saudi League association in 2022. Years.

Tered, who started the final round with a three-reckon, fell behind late in Maridoe Golf Club as Jinichiro Kozuma made Bogee in 18. hole, then made in his last hole in no. 1 for 68.

It caught him in playoff with Reed, Louis Oosthuizen (68) and Paul Casey (72).

Oosthuizen drove into the water on the first additional hole, and Casey took four shots to get to Green on a par-4 18. The goat missed his 25-foot bird, putting the stage for reeds.

Reed said it was a relief to get his first victory in his home state of Texas. He won in Hong Kong opened last year on the Asian tour, but he went 0 for 41 on Liv Golf.

“To get the first victory here, part of Liv, that means so much to me,” said Reed. “I tried to mess up. After I made a bird first, I seemed to leave me every time.”

Bryson Dechambeau soaped his final hole, significant only because he first knocked Jon Rahm from the top 10 in Liv Golf.

Sergio Garcia was never a factor, but he ends in a week 5 in the point that stands, earning a lonely place on the British open for Liv Golf players in the top five on the table that is not already eligible for the royal portrush.
